The uW can be licensed under the CARS rules and by the cable
company. The license can not be in the name of the local access channel.
Be VERY careful about the channels selected. The 2/2.5 Ghz channels
are undergoing a MAJOR repositioning due to MSS and Nextel's spectrum
re-allocations and are going digital. So analog equipment will be
obsolete minute one.
I would contact a consultant familiar with this type of service to
guide you. CARS is a straight forward use like broadcast. And there
are some channels available exclusively for CARS as well.
